'Every little bit of progress helps' – Kimi Räikkönen

Kimi Räikkönen has been pleased with Alfa Romeo Racing‘s recent run of results but is adamant that there is still a lot of work to be done in order for that to keep going. The Iceman finished eighth in the last race at Silverstone to go on a streak of three rounds in the points. The Swiss squad aim to close the gap to Renault F1 Team, as they are currently thirteen points behind the French squad in sixth position in the Constructors' Championship. The most experienced driver on the grid also lies eighth in the drivers standings, thirteen points off seventh place Carlos Sainz Jr. and battling race by race to catch up to the young Spaniard.
